Crimes and Offenders Punishable By Death
.
.
.
.
Rape of Adult Not Resulting in Death.
An assault on a woman and intentional display of her body in public view is punishable by death. [13] Rape by a man, especially a gang rape, is punishable by death. Abduction to submit another to unnatural lust, which may include homosexual sex, is punishable by death. [14]

Rape of Child Not Resulting in Death.
Statutory rape by a man of a girl under 16, especially a gang rape, is punishable by death. Abduction to submit another to unnatural lust, which may include abduction for rape of minors or for homosexual sex, is punishable by death. [15]

The Death Penalty in Pakistan

It is legislated under
Pakistan Penal Code, 1860, section 376; Offence of Zina (Enforcement of Hudood) Ordinance, 1979, section 5.
